31727057 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 31727058. Its totient is φ = 31727056.

The previous prime is 31727053. The next prime is 31727081. The reversal of 31727057 is 75072713.

It is a weak pr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 27920656 + 3806401 = 5284^2 + 1951^2 .

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 31727057 - 22 = 31727053 is a prime.

It is a super-2 number, since 2×317270572 = 2013212291762498, which contains 22 as substring.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(31727053) by changing a digit.

It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(13) of ones.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 15863528 + 15863529.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(15863529).

Almost surely, 231727057 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

31727057 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

31727057 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

31727057 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 10290, while the sum is 32.

The square root of 31727057 is about 5632.6776048341. The cubic root of 31727057 is about 316.5749859555.

The spelling of 31727057 in words is "thirty-one million, seven hundred twenty-seven thousand, fifty-seven".
